Effective Natural Ways to Improve Vitamin D

Regular Sunlight Exposure
Spending time outdoors is one of the most effective ways to support Vitamin D production.
Include Vitamin D Rich Foods
Foods such as mushrooms, fortified dairy, and cereals may help support daily intake.
Maintain Active Lifestyle
Physical activity encourages outdoor exposure and overall wellness.
Build Consistent Routine
Consistency is key. Irregular exposure may not provide sufficient support.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Relying Only on Diet
Diet alone may not provide enough Vitamin D.
Avoiding Sunlight Completely
Fear of heat often leads people to avoid sunlight entirely.
